Chelsea ‘eye’ shock move for £100m Man United star as Pulisic replacement
According to reports, Chelsea are considering making a shock move for Manchester United winger Jadon Sancho as a possible replacement for Christian Pulisic.
Pulisic has struggled for regular playing time under Graham Potter and the 22-year-old is reportedly pushing for a move away from Stamford Bridge.
According Italian media outlet Calciomercato, Chelsea sees Sancho as the ideal replacement for the American international and that the club owner Todd Boehly is ready to sanction a move for the 22-year-old.

Sancho was left out of England’s squad for the 2022 World Cup in Qatar and he is not part of the the Red Devils’ squad in Spain for their warm weather training camp in Spain as he has been having individual training in Netherlands with coaches recommended by Man United manager Erik ten Hag.
